I have gotta say man we can try to get those replaced, but that is stuff you will find normally in doubleshot keycaps. The issue of the F looks like a demolding nick, and the kerning on the R is definitely a little off but nothing that would be rejected by QC.

Please be sure to save all of your photos as they may be required to make your claim with GMK.

Ya I'm not too worried about the F. I misspoke when I said malformed, I didn't mean the legend itself. The R key looks like it has a dent in it from every angle because the stem is showing through. There probably is an actual depression there where maybe the entire mold hadn't been filled or something (air?). I don't know enough about to say exactly.

Generally this is a standard molding concern with injection molded keys.  Because the plastic structure changes temperature at different rates a key can shift when demolded, and because the finish of the key is normally so uniform on a perfect shot you can see any variation in the finish of a not so perfect key if the variance is on the scale of 1000-100nm.

::EDIT:: if you ever get into PBT dyesub caps you'll see this behavior much more often.  When the keys are reheated to sublimate the applied dye the key will warp ever so slightly.  To clarify how this relates to doubleshots... Hot plastic is injected for the first color, and the 2nd color is injected after the first color sets to hard plastic.  The application of the 2nd color being near the melting temperature of the 1st plastic by the time it reaches the mold causes slight warps.
